Last wicket stand frustrates Derbyshire against Glamorgan

A last wicket stand frustrated Derbyshire after Tony Palladino had completed his 12th five wicket haul on the second morning of the match against Glamorgan at Derby.

Palladino struck twice as Glamorgan lost three wickets in four overs to slide to 314 for 9 before Timm van der Gugten and Andrew Salter added 63 in 15 overs.

Van der Gugten twice dispatched Matt Critchley’s leg-spin for six, the second landing on the pavilion roof, and there were also four fours in his 36 which came off 48 balls.

After a brief rain delay, Derbyshire’s openers had a tricky four overs to negotiate before lunch but Ben Slater and Chesney Hughes survived with few alarms as the home side moved to 23 without loss, 354 runs behind.
